I using eclipse, at project properties -> Flex compiler -> Aditional compiler arguments I got this -locale en_US -services "../WebContent/WEB-INF/flex/services-config.xml"
but how you say, it seens founding.

I remember when I moved from adobe to apache I had some issues with blazeds I just dont remember what it was, it could be even the blazeds version. Last week I update blazeds and also got more one issue in the sintaxe.

Let me show you how I did here:
------------------------------------
remoting-config.xml

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<service id="remoting-service" class="flex.messaging.services.RemotingService">
    <adapters>
<adapter-definition id="java-object" class="flex.messaging.services.remoting.adapters.JavaAdapter" default="true"/>
    </adapters>
    <default-channels>
        <channel ref="my-amf"/>
    </default-channels>
    <destination id="oframework">
        <properties>
<source>evf_framework.Framework</source>
        </properties>
    </destination>
</service>

------------------------------
services-config.xml

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<services-config>
    <services>
<service-include directory-path="../WebContent/WEB-INF/flex/" file-path="remoting-config.xml" /> <service-include directory-path="../WebContent/WEB-INF/flex/" file-path="proxy-config.xml" /> <service-include directory-path="../WebContent/WEB-INF/flex/" file-path="messaging-config.xml" />
    </services>
    <security>
<login-command class="flex.messaging.security.TomcatLoginCommand"
            server="Tomcat" />
    </security>
    <channels>
        <channel-definition id="my-amf"
            class="mx.messaging.channels.AMFChannel">
            <endpoint
url="http://{server.name}:{server.port}/{context.root}/messagebroker/amf";
                class="flex.messaging.endpoints.AMFEndpoint" />
        </channel-definition>
    </channels>
    <system>
        <redeploy>
            <enabled>false</enabled>
        </redeploy>
    </system>
</services-config>
------------------------------------------------
Inside application
<fx:Declarations>
<s:RemoteObject id="framework" destination="oframework" requestTimeout="120">
        </s:RemoteObject>
</fx:Declarations>

Hi,

i migrated from adobe's sdk to the new apache sdk, I'm using Flashdevelop. In my project I'm using Amfphp, so i have a services-config.xml in the project root. In the compiler options (flashdevelop) i put "-services services-config.xml" this worked with the adobe sdk (same project), but with the apache sdk i get :

faultCode:InvokeFailed faultString:'[MessagingError message='Destination 'zend' either does not exist or the destination has no channels defined (and the application does not define any default channels.)']' faultDetail:'Couldn't establish a connection to 'zend''

I downloaded the sdk with the BlazeDS option selected .
What I'm doing wrong?
